当百度指数访问过于频繁时,用户可能会遇到访问限制或数据加载缓慢的问题。为了解决这一问题,可以采取以下几种方法:1. 减少访问频率,避免在短时间内频繁查询同一关键词。2. 使用百度指数的API服务,合理分配请求次数,以降低单次访问频率。3. 尝试在非高峰时段访问百度指数,以减少服务器压力。4. 如果是企业用户,可以考虑购买百度指数的商业版服务,以获得更高的访问权限和更稳定的数据服务。通过以上方法,可以有效缓解百度指数访问频繁的问题,提高数据查询效率。
在互联网时代,数据的获取和分析成为了企业和个人决策的重要依据,百度指数作为中国最大的搜索引擎之一——百度推出的数据分享平台,提供了关键词搜索趋势、用户画像等数据服务,对于市场研究、竞争分析等方面具有重要价值,在使用百度指数时,用户可能会遇到访问过于频繁的问题,导致无法正常获取数据,本文将探讨遇到这种情况时的解决方案。
1. 理解访问限制的原因
我们需要了解为什么百度指数会有访问限制,这种限制通常是出于以下几个原因:
防止滥用:避免用户过度请求数据,导致服务器负载过重。
数据安全:保护用户数据不被恶意爬取。
商业利益:部分数据服务可能需要付费才能获得更高的访问权限。
了解这些原因后,我们可以更有针对性地寻找解决方案。
2. 减少访问频率
最直接的解决方案是减少访问频率,可以尝试以下方法:
间隔访问:设置合理的时间间隔,比如每5分钟访问一次,以避免触发频率限制。
分时访问:选择在流量较低的时段进行访问,比如凌晨或非工作日。
3. 使用API服务
如果需要频繁访问百度指数数据,可以考虑使用百度指数提供的API服务,通过API,可以更灵活地控制访问频率和数据量,但需要注意的是,API服务可能需要申请权限,并且可能涉及到费用。
申请API权限:按照百度指数的官方指引申请API权限。
合理使用API:在API使用文档的指导下,合理设置请求参数和频率。
4. 缓存数据
如果数据的实时性要求不高,可以考虑缓存数据,将一段时间内的数据保存下来,减少对百度指数的访问次数。
本地存储:将获取的数据保存在本地数据库或文件中。
定期更新:根据需要定期更新缓存数据,以保证数据的相对新鲜度。
5. 多账号轮换使用
如果百度指数的访问限制是基于账号的,可以尝试使用多个账号轮换访问。
账号管理:创建多个百度账号,用于访问百度指数。
轮换机制:设计一个轮换机制,确保每个账号的访问频率都保持在限制范围内。
6. 技术手段规避限制
对于技术能力较强的用户,可以尝试使用一些技术手段来规避访问限制,但请注意,这些方法可能违反百度指数的服务条款,存在被封号的风险。
代理服务器:使用不同的IP地址访问百度指数,以规避基于IP的限制。
用户代理:更改HTTP请求中的User-Agent,模拟不同的浏览器或设备访问。
7. 考虑替代方案
如果百度指数的访问限制严重影响了数据获取,可以考虑寻找替代方案。
其他数据平台:使用其他提供类似服务的平台,如谷歌趋势、阿里指数等。
定制数据服务:与数据服务商合作,定制所需的数据服务。
8. 遵守规则,合理使用
也是最重要的一点,是遵守百度指数的使用规则,合理使用数据服务,过度请求数据不仅可能触发访问限制,还可能对百度指数的服务器造成不必要的负担。
阅读服务条款:仔细阅读百度指数的服务条款,了解使用限制。
合理规划数据需求:根据实际需求合理规划数据获取计划,避免不必要的频繁访问。
百度指数作为一个强大的数据服务平台,为我们提供了丰富的数据资源,在使用过程中,我们可能会遇到访问过于频繁的问题,通过上述方法,我们可以有效地规避这一问题,更好地利用百度指数提供的数据服务,我们也应意识到,合理使用数据服务,遵守平台规则,是每个用户应尽的责任。
转载请注明来自我有希望,本文标题:《百度指数访问过于频繁怎么办?》